    This change makes documentation of the the gpio-ranges property shorter
    and more succinct, more consistent with the style of the rest of the
    document, and not mention Linux-specifics such as the API
    pinctrl_request_gpio(); DT binding documents should be OS independant
    where at all possible. As part of this, the gpio-ranges property's format
    is described in BNF form, in order to match the rest of the document.
    
    This change also deprecates the #gpio-range-cells property. Such
    properties are useful when one node references a second node, and that
    second node dictates the format of the reference. However, that is not
    the case here; the definition of gpio-ranges itself always dictates its
    format entirely, and hence the value #gpio-range-cells must always be 3,
    and hence there is no point requiring any referenced node to include
    this property. The only remaining need for this property is to ensure
    compatibility of DTs with older SW that was written to support the
    previous version of the binding.
    
    v4:
    * Mention #gpio-range-cells as being deprecated, rather than removing all
      documentation of that property. This allows DTs to be written in a
      backwards-compatible way if desired, and also allows older DTs to be
      interpreted fully using the latest documentation.
    v3:
    * Mention BNF in commit description.
    * Fixed typo.
    * Dropped patch that removed the deprecated property from *.dts, since
      it's required to boot older kernels.
